MATH 16000s and 16010s: Students enrolling in the MATH 16000s sequences must complete MATH16200 Honors Calculus II or MATH16210 Honors Calculus II (IBL) before enrolling in ECON20000 The Elements of Economic Analysis I. Enrollment in ECON20000 The Elements of Economic Analysis I requires completion or concurrent enrollment in MATH16300 Honors Calculus III/MATH16310 Honors Calculus III (IBL) and demonstrated competency in Microeconomics (see Core Curriculum for details). This course is designed to guide groups of students through the new venture creation process. Students will learn how to raise seed funding, compensate for limited human and financial resources, establish brand values and positioning, secure a strong niche position, determine appropriate sourcing and sales channels, and develop execution plans in sales, marketing, product development and operations.
